Transaction 6d6840a285305286eae596fc63594466add444b08e56dae2a998bd0e5784b4f8
1 Input
1 Output
-
6d6840a285305286eae596fc63594466add444b08e56dae2a998bd0e5784b4f8:0
- value
- 549590
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0eb857e36552bc8c1b4b5661ae2637baf7742b1e OP_EQUAL
- address
- 332rDdLfEuje2rj5AVrzZS4JLiUpECsYd6